How Frozen Pipe Water Removal Works

When you call our team for Frozen Pipe Water Removal, you can rest assured that our experienced technicians will arrive quickly and get to work immediately. Our process is designed to reduce damage, prevent secondary damage, and ensure safe living conditions for you and your family. Here's what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our technicians will ass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. We'll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ure that all affected areas are identified.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ring that our restoration efforts are targeted and effective.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

Once the affected area has been identified, our team will use powerful pumps and extraction equipment to remove the standing water. We'll work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been removed, our technicians will use specialized drying equipment to dry the affected area. This step is critical in preventing secondary damage, such as warping or cracking, and ensuring that your home is safe and healthy to live in.

Step 4: Cleanup and Sanitizing

Once the affected area has been dried,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We'll use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ure that your home is left safe and healthy.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Before we leave your home,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all affected areas have been restored to their original condition. We'll also provide you with a certification of completion, which includes a detailed report of the work we've done and any recommendations for future maintenance or repairs.

Frozen Pipe Water Removal Cost in Arcadia, AZ

The cost of Frozen Pipe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Arcadia,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Frozen Pipe Water Remov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water removed,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, amount of drying equipment needed, and duration of drying process
Cleanup and Sanitizing $100 - $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ning equipment needed, and duration of cleaning process
Final Inspection and Certification $50 - $200 Size of affected area, complexity of inspection, and duration of certification process
